Make sure you have a good speed, you want to be going a good speed so both tires can clear. Than just focus on getting a good pull up, the higher your front end the higher you can hop. When I hop I get ready to whip a bit to make it easier for my legs to bend and when my tire hits you it wont go right up your ass.
